Deputy Pearse Doherty asked the Minister for Children and Youth Affairs the total number of persons currently employed by Tusla; the number of these who are social workers, social care professionals, psychologists, counsellors, nursing staff, education and welfare officers, family support staff, other support staff including staff caterers, administration staff grades 3 to 7 and management grades 8 and above, in tabular form;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[12748/17]

View answer

Written answers

The Child and Family Agency (Tusla) has advised that at the end of January, 2017 there were 3,616.02 whole-time equivalent staff directly employed. The numerical breakdown of staff by category is set down in tabular format below:

Category

Whole time equivalent staff

January 2017

Social Work

1,467.45

Social Care

1,114.99

Psychology and Counselling

23.40

Other Support Staff inc catering

63.04

Other Health Professionals

9.76

Nursing

49.91

Management Grade VIII

106.97

Family Support

165.72

Education and Welfare Officer

86.84

Admin Grade III-VII

527.94

Total

3,616.02
